What is Psychiatry?
Psychiatry is a branch of medication concentrated on the diagnosis, treatment, and prevention of mental health conditions. Psychiatrists are medical doctors who have completed customized training in mental health, incorporating different techniques of care such as medication management, psychotherapy, and other healing interventions.
Table 1: Key Functions of a Psychiatrist
| Function | Description |
|---|---|
| Diagnosis | Examining and detecting mental health conditions, including their intensity and effect. |
| Treatment Planning | Establishing customized treatment strategies based on a client's needs and choices. |
| Medication Management | Recommending and handling psychiatric medications to mitigate symptoms of mental health conditions. |
| Psychotherapy | Supplying various types of treatment, such as c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) and psychodynamic therapy. |
| Keeping an eye on Progress | Frequently examining the efficiency of treatment and making needed changes for much better outcomes. |
| Education and Advocacy | Helping clients and families comprehend mental health problems and advocating for enhanced care and resources. |

Kinds Of Mental Health Disorders Treated by Psychiatrists
Psychiatrists deal with a broad range of mental health conditions, including but not restricted to:
- Anxiety Disorders (Generalized Anxiety Disorder, Social Anxiety)
- Mood Disorders (Depression, Bipolar Disorder)
- Psychotic Disorders (Schizophrenia, Delusional Disorder)
- Eating Disorders (Anorexia Nervosa, Bulimia Nervosa)
- Substance Use Disorders
- Trauma (PTSD)
- Obsessive-Compulsive Disorder (OCD)

Frequently asked questions About Psychiatry
1. What qualifications do psychiatrists require?
Psychiatrists need to finish a Bachelor's degree followed by a medical degree (MD or DO), a residency in private psychiatry clinic, and frequently additional fellowship training for specialization.

3. What can I anticipate during a psychiatric evaluation?
A thorough assessment normally consists of an evaluation of medical history, a conversation of symptoms, and possibly standardized questionnaires to help in diagnosis.
